Thinking about a career in teaching? This Thursday (19th February) in Keynes Atrium from 10am – 2pm, come and meet representatives from Teach First and Get into Teaching, to discover teaching pathways.

Get into Teaching is run by the Department for Education, offering free advice and guidance. Explore training routes, funding options, salaries, events and more. Come and chat to their Ambassadors about how they can help you in your teaching career. Further event details can be found here.

Teach First is an organisation dedicated to addressing inequality. Their role is to identify ambitious finalists and inspire and equip them to lead change on a national scale. This is your opportunity to join one of the UK’s most prestigious graduate programmes – consistently ranked in the top 15 of Times Top 100 Graduate Employers. They’re here to help you build a rewarding career where you can make a real-world impact on the lives of young people from disadvantaged backgrounds. Teach First are actively recruiting for their STEM Teaching Programme and are looking to speak to final year STEM students. Further event details can be found here.
